The Dark Knight is still the reigning champ at the box office. Here is the box office estimate for the weekend of August 8-10:

The Dark Knight--$26 million
Pineapple Express--$22.4 million
The Mummy: Tomb of the Dragon Emperor--$16.1 million
The Sisterhood of the Traveling Pants 2--$10.7 million
Step Brothers--$8.9 million
Mamma Mia!--$8 million
Journey to the Center of the Earth--$4.8 million
Hancock--$3.3 million
Swing Vote--$3.1 million
Wall-E--$3 million
TGIF! It's that time of week again! Here are this week's new releases:

Pineapple Express:
Seth Rogen and James Franco are stoners who go on the run after witnessing a murder by a crooked cop and a dangerous drug lord.

The Sisterhood of the Traveling Pants 2:
Four lifelong friends wear the traveling pants again and embark on separate paths for their first year of college and beyond.
